/Industries/Banking
Banking QA

Software testing for banking systems where every transaction counts

QAble delivers QA for core banking platforms, mobile banking applications, payment processing systems, and KYC/AML workflows — covering transaction accuracy, security, regulatory compliance, and resilience across every release.

Testing coverage for:

Core Banking ValidationPayment Gateway TestingKYC / AML Workflow QAMobile Banking QASecurity & VAPTAPI & Open BankingDisaster Recovery TestingRegulatory Compliance

Engineering teams that rely on QAble

Astrocade
Augmont
Capermint
CivilQR
Colpal
Drive Buddy Ai
EigenRisk
Experience Abu Dhabi
Flipkart
FYNDNA
Godrej
HDFC Bank
Hills
InnovAge
Innovaccer
International Chamber of Shipping
Kotak Mahindra
Kuku FM
Level Shoes
Marriott Bonvoy
MyLoft
Nevvon
OPL
Pentair
Rocket
Ruupya
Sadad
Saleshandy
Satschel Inc
Upwork
Vrettaw
WinZO
Zatun
Zeguro
Astrocade
Augmont
Capermint
CivilQR
Colpal
Drive Buddy Ai
EigenRisk
Experience Abu Dhabi
Flipkart
FYNDNA
Godrej
HDFC Bank
Hills
InnovAge
Innovaccer
International Chamber of Shipping
Kotak Mahindra
Kuku FM
Level Shoes
Marriott Bonvoy
MyLoft
Nevvon
OPL
Pentair
Rocket
Ruupya
Sadad
Saleshandy
Satschel Inc
Upwork
Vrettaw
WinZO
Zatun
Zeguro
The Problem

Where banking software failures cost trust as much as money

QAble brings QA engineers with banking domain context who understand settlement logic, KYC obligations, and the security threat model specific to financial account management — not just test execution against a spec.

Without banking QA coverage

01

core banking calculation errors — in interest accruals, overdraft logic, or balance reconciliation — cause direct financial loss and regulatory reporting failures

02

payment processing failures during peak settlement windows strand transactions and trigger customer escalations and SLA penalties

03

KYC and AML workflow gaps allow non-compliant onboarding that results in regulatory fines and remediation programmes

04

mobile banking security vulnerabilities expose customer accounts to credential theft, session hijacking, and fraudulent transfers

05

third-party Open Banking API failures break partner integrations and create data consistency gaps in customer account views

The QAble Solution

Banking QA must validate the business logic, the security boundary, and the compliance record — a single failure in any layer can trigger customer loss, regulatory action, or both.

Talk to QA Advisor

Zero Settlement Errors

in payment and transaction reconciliation

KYC / AML Coverage

full onboarding workflow validation

99.99% Uptime

validated under peak settlement load

Open Banking APIs

schema and contract validation included

Coverage Areas

Banking QA Coverage Areas

QAble covers the full breadth of quality risk across banking platforms, integrations, and compliance requirements.

01

Core Banking System Testing

End-to-end validation of account management, balance calculations, interest accruals, overdraft logic, and GL reconciliation — covering edge cases that production rarely surfaces until they matter most.

account lifecycle testing
interest and fee calculations
GL reconciliation checks
overdraft and limit logic
02

Payment & Settlement Testing

Validation of SWIFT, SEPA, ACH, and domestic payment flows — covering transaction routing, settlement windows, retry logic, and error handling for failed or returned payments.

SWIFT / SEPA / ACH flows
settlement window validation
failed payment retry logic
real-time payment rails
03

KYC / AML Testing

Functional and compliance testing of customer onboarding, identity verification, PEP/sanctions screening, and transaction monitoring workflows — aligned to FCA, FinCEN, and regional AML requirements.

onboarding workflow validation
PEP and sanctions screening
transaction monitoring alerts
SAR generation testing
04

Mobile Banking QA

Real-device testing of mobile banking applications across iOS and Android — covering biometric authentication, deep link security, offline mode, push notification accuracy, and platform-specific behaviour.

biometric auth testing
deep link and URL scheme security
offline and sync behaviour
real-device matrix coverage
05

Open Banking & API Testing

Schema-level and contract testing for Open Banking APIs (PSD2, CDR) — covering consent management, data sharing accuracy, rate limiting, and third-party provider integration resilience.

PSD2 / CDR API testing
consent flow validation
TPP integration testing
API contract and schema tests
06

Security & Resilience Testing

OWASP-aligned VAPT covering authentication, session management, API security, and data-at-rest encryption — plus disaster recovery and failover testing for core transaction systems.

OWASP Top 10 VAPT
session hijacking resistance
disaster recovery validation
data encryption verification
Process

QAble Banking QA Methodology

A disciplined process designed to deliver quality confidence across every banking release.

Regulatory Mapping

Map applicable banking regulations — FCA, RBI, APRA, FinCEN — to system components. Define KYC, AML, and data handling test obligations before scope is set.

Test Environment Setup

Configure sandboxed core banking and payment environments using masked or synthetic data. No real customer account data enters the test environment.

Core Logic Testing

Execute calculation, settlement, and KYC workflow tests against the core banking system — the accuracy foundation before performance and security layers are validated.

Security & Mobile Runs

Run targeted VAPT across banking APIs and mobile apps, and load test settlement systems against peak transaction volumes.

Compliance Sign-off

Release report covering KYC/AML test evidence, security findings, settlement accuracy, and open risk items — structured for internal audit and regulatory review.

Deliverables

What you receive

QAble provides structured documentation and evidence your team can act on immediately.

Core Banking Test Report

account and balance accuracy
interest calculation log
GL reconciliation results
overdraft logic coverage

Compliance Evidence

KYC / AML test results
sanctions screening validation
payment flow test log
regulatory control evidence

Security & Performance

OWASP VAPT findings
mobile security test report
settlement load test results
resilience test evidence

Continuous Assets

core banking regression suite
API contract test collection
KYC scenario library
performance baseline report
Risk Patterns

Common Banking QA Risks We Identify

These risk patterns recur when banking platforms lack structured QA coverage.

Critical01

Settlement Logic Not Regression Tested

Core banking calculation changes — even minor — can silently break settlement accuracy across thousands of transactions. Regression suites covering GL reconciliation and settlement logic are non-negotiable.

Critical02

KYC Workflow Gaps in Onboarding

Incomplete KYC testing allows non-compliant customer onboarding paths — including bypasses in identity verification or PEP screening — that become regulatory findings during examination.

High03

Mobile App Not Tested on Real Devices

Emulator-only mobile banking testing misses platform-specific issues — biometric authentication failures, deep link security gaps, and notification delivery problems — that surface in production on real devices.

High04

Open Banking API Contracts Not Validated

PSD2 and CDR API contracts that are tested only against internal assumptions fail when third-party providers consume them — breaking partner integrations that banking customers depend on daily.

Medium05

Load Testing Not Based on Settlement Peaks

Banking systems that are load tested at average traffic miss the settlement window patterns that cause the most failures — end-of-day, month-end, and holiday periods require specific load profiles.

Medium06

Disaster Recovery Not Tested End-to-End

Documented DR procedures that are never tested end-to-end frequently fail when actually needed — transaction loss and data inconsistency during failover are common findings in untested recovery scenarios.

Engagement Models

Ways to work with QAble

From targeted payment system sprints to full QA pod coverage for regulated banking platforms — structured for your release cadence and regulatory obligations.

Release-Focused

1–3 weeks

Targeted QA Engagement

Focused quality assurance coverage for a specific release, milestone, or risk area within your product.

Deliverables

Test coverage report
Defect log with severity
Risk summary
Prioritised action brief

Best for

Pre-release hardening
Specific feature validation
Get Started
Most Popular

4–8 weeks

Full QA Programme

End-to-end quality programme covering functional coverage, integrations, compliance checks, and deliverable documentation.

Deliverables

Full test strategy
Compliance validation
Integration test suite
Executive quality report

Best for

Platform releases
Regulatory milestone readiness
Get Started
Flexible

Ongoing

Continuous QA Partnership

Embedded QA aligned with your sprint cadence — delivering ongoing coverage, automation, and quality intelligence each release.

Deliverables

Sprint QA reports
Automation framework
Regression suite
Trend and risk tracking

Best for

Continuous delivery teams
High-velocity product orgs
Get Started
Every model includes:
Certified QA engineersNDA on day oneDirect Slack accessDedicated account managerZero lock-in contracts
Why QAble

Why choose QAble

QAble brings domain-specific QA methodology built for banking products — evidence-first, compliance-aware, and release-confident.

QA engineers with banking domain experience — settlement logic, KYC obligations, and Open Banking API standards are understood, not just tested
Masking and synthetic data management built in — no real customer account data enters test environments at any point
Regulatory evidence artefacts produced as standard — KYC/AML test results and compliance control logs ready for examiner review
Mobile banking tested on real devices across iOS and Android — not emulators that miss platform-specific failures

QAble Banking Testing Expertise

Core Banking & Settlement Testing94%
KYC / AML Workflow Testing91%
Mobile Banking QA89%
Open Banking API Testing87%
Security & Resilience Testing92%
FAQ

Frequently asked questions

Common questions about QAble's banking testing approach and deliverables.

Can QAble test our core banking integration without accessing real customer accounts?

Yes. QAble uses masked or synthetically generated account data for all core banking test environments. We configure test environments to mirror production data structures without containing real customer identifiers, balances, or transaction histories — maintaining data handling compliance throughout.

How does QAble approach KYC and AML workflow testing?

We design scenario-based tests that cover the full onboarding journey — identity verification, document checks, PEP and sanctions screening, and adverse media flagging. Test scenarios include both compliant and non-compliant customer profiles to validate that the system correctly accepts, flags, or rejects each case. Results are structured as compliance evidence.

Does QAble test mobile banking apps on real devices?

Yes. QAble maintains real-device coverage across iOS and Android using both in-house devices and cloud-based real-device platforms (BrowserStack, Sauce Labs). Emulators are used for initial coverage but are never the sole test environment for banking apps where biometric authentication, deep link security, and notification behaviour need platform-level validation.

Can QAble support Open Banking API testing for PSD2 compliance?

Yes. We validate Open Banking APIs against PSD2 and CDR schema requirements, test consent management flows, and run integration tests simulating third-party provider consumption. Contract testing using Pact ensures that API changes do not silently break TPP integrations that banking customers depend on.

Ship banking software that passes every transaction test, and every audit

QAble brings banking domain expertise, compliant test data management, and regulatory evidence production to every banking software engagement.

Banking QA built for accuracy and compliance

QAble covers core banking logic, payment settlement, KYC/AML workflows, mobile banking, Open Banking APIs, and security — with compliance evidence artefacts produced at every release.

No sales pitch
Technical walkthrough
No lock-in commitment
Talk to QA Advisor

Talk to QA Advisor

Direct access to QAble's banking testing specialists.

Response within 24 hours